Many thanks chaps/chapesses. Carmelite I think is the old newspaper office (Carmelite House) Daily Express?), and probably just a registered office address. I don't think that anyone is actually there !!!!
The Richmond address is another post office box number address, but would, I admit, seem to show that they are somewhere in the Richmond/Twickenham Surrey area, as it would seem, so are Paypal.
There surely must be a contact address for a human being and some physical corporate structure with whom one can deal for day to day business matters. They advertise on commmercial television, so where are they and how do you deal with them direct?